Galieve

Galieve is a combination medicine that neutralizes excess stomach acid and forms a protective layer over stomach contents, relieving heartburn and indigestion.

How to Use

Dosage

10–20 ml (1-2 sachets) for adults, elderly, and children 12 years and older.

Method

Take after meals and before bedtime. Oral suspension.

Important

Maximum four times per day.

Important Warnings

  • Do not use if you are allergic to any ingredient in Galieve.
  • Talk to a doctor if you have severe kidney problems.
  • Talk to a doctor if you have an electrolyte imbalance or low phosphate levels in your blood.
  • Talk to a doctor if you have kidney or heart disease, as the salts in Galieve may affect these conditions.
  • Talk to a doctor if you know you have reduced stomach acid, as the medicine may be less effective.

  • If symptoms persist for more than 7 days, contact your doctor.
  • Children under 12 years should only use this medicine under a doctor's guidance.
  • Do not take other oral medicines two hours before or two hours after Galieve, as it may affect their action.
